HT REPORT
There are at least two good things about the first half.
First we're winning 1-0 - a powerful Austin low 17th minute shot from just outside the box after Dykes had robbed Souttar.
The second is a lush surface - thick grass in stripes just like a zebra crossing.
This makes it easy for the linesman to call any offside.
I'd love to have some of that lush surface in my garden!
Not much of a cohesive pattern from a QPR point of view.
But outstanding yet again is Jojo - whether intercepting in defence or creating openings for his midfield or strike partners.
Willock continues to be impressive and Dieng - now unmasked - wearing a nose strip - shows why he is our No.1 keeper. He commands his box - punches out when necesssary and so far continues to make vital catches from crosses. Not that Stoke have tested him. Their shots have been so wayward.
We are deservedly in front - always look threatening.
Another goal would be nice to settle this issue and give us 3 successive wins on the road.
